在当今数字化时代,服务器作为企业业务的核心支撑,其性能的优劣直接影响到业务的开展与用户体验,为了确保服务器能够稳定高效地运行,服务器性能测试安装工作至关重要,本文将深入探讨服务器性能测试安装的相关内容,包括测试的重要性、安装前的准备工作、常见的性能测试工具以及安装过程中的关键步骤和注意事项等,为相关从业者提供全面且实用的指导。
一、服务器性能测试的重要性
服务器性能测试是对服务器硬件、软件以及网络配置等多方面的综合评估,通过模拟真实的业务场景和负载情况,可以提前发现服务器可能存在的性能瓶颈,如 CPU 利用率过高、内存不足、磁盘 I/O 瓶颈、网络带宽饱和等问题,这些问题如果在实际业务运行中出现,可能会导致系统响应缓慢、服务中断甚至数据丢失等严重后果,给企业带来巨大的经济损失和声誉损害,在服务器投入使用之前进行全面的性能测试是保障系统稳定运行的必要举措。
二、服务器性能测试安装前的准备工作
在进行服务器性能测试之前,需要根据业务需求和服务器的使用场景明确测试目标,是用于承载高并发的 Web 应用、数据库服务还是文件存储等,不同的应用场景对服务器性能的要求有所不同,测试重点也会有所差异。
详细了解服务器的硬件配置,包括 CPU 型号、核心数、频率,内存大小、类型和频率,磁盘的类型、容量、转速以及网络接口卡的速率等信息,这些信息有助于确定测试的范围和预期性能指标,并为后续选择合适的测试工具和方法提供依据。
市场上存在多种服务器性能测试工具,如 JMeter、LoadRunner 等,JMeter 是一款开源的测试工具,主要用于对 Java 应用程序进行性能测试,它可以模拟大量的用户并发访问,测试服务器的响应时间、吞吐量等性能指标;LoadRunner 则是一款功能强大的商业测试工具,能够支持多种协议和技术架构,适用于各种复杂的业务场景性能测试,在选择测试工具时,需要根据服务器的应用类型、测试预算以及团队的技术能力等因素综合考虑。
为了保证测试结果的准确性和可靠性,需要搭建一个与生产环境相似的测试环境,这包括安装相同版本的操作系统、数据库管理系统、中间件以及应用程序等软件组件,并配置相应的网络参数和安全策略,还需要准备足够的测试数据,以模拟真实的业务数据量和数据分布情况。
三、服务器性能测试安装过程
以 JMeter 为例,首先从官方网站下载适合操作系统版本的 JMeter 安装包,然后按照安装向导的提示进行安装,在安装过程中可以选择默认的安装路径和组件配置,安装完成后,需要对 JMeter 进行基本的配置,如设置线程组、添加采样器、配置监听器等,以定义测试计划和性能指标收集方式。
根据测试目标和业务需求,设计详细的测试用例,测试用例应涵盖各种正常和异常的业务操作场景,包括不同用户负载条件下的功能测试、性能测试、压力测试以及稳定性测试等,对于一个电商网站的服务器性能测试,测试用例可以包括用户登录、商品浏览、下单支付等功能操作在不同并发用户数下的性能表现,以及服务器在长时间高负载运行情况下的稳定性测试。
在准备好测试环境和测试用例后,即可开始执行服务器性能测试,在测试过程中,要密切关注服务器的各项性能指标,如 CPU 使用率、内存占用率、磁盘 I/O 读写速度、网络带宽利用率等,并及时记录测试数据和结果,如果发现性能指标异常或不符合预期,需要对服务器进行进一步的排查和优化,如调整系统参数、优化应用程序代码或增加硬件资源等,然后重新执行测试,直到达到满意的性能指标为止。
测试完成后,对收集到的大量测试数据进行分析和总结,通过绘制图表、计算统计值等方式,直观地展示服务器在不同负载条件下的性能表现,找出性能瓶颈所在的位置和原因,如果发现 CPU 使用率过高,可能是由于某个应用程序的算法复杂度过高或者存在死循环等问题导致;如果内存占用率持续上升且无法释放,可能是由于内存泄漏问题引起的,针对这些问题,提出相应的优化建议和解决方案,为服务器的性能调优提供依据。
四、服务器性能测试安装后的优化与维护
服务器性能测试安装并不是一次性的工作,而是一个持续的过程,在服务器投入实际运行后,仍需要定期对其进行性能监测和优化维护,可以使用一些性能监测工具,如 Nagios、Zabbix 等,实时监控服务器的各项性能指标,及时发现潜在的性能问题并进行处理,根据业务的发展和技术的更新,适时对服务器进行升级和优化,如更换更高性能的硬件设备、升级操作系统和应用程序版本等,以确保服务器始终能够满足业务的需求,为企业的稳定发展提供有力保障。
服务器性能测试安装是保障服务器稳定高效运行的关键环节,通过充分的准备工作、严谨的测试过程以及持续的优化维护,可以有效地发现和解决服务器性能问题,提高服务器的可靠性和可用性,为企业的业务发展奠定坚实的基础,在未来的数字化进程中,随着技术的不断发展和业务需求的日益复杂,服务器性能测试安装工作也将面临更多的挑战和机遇,相关从业者需要不断学习和掌握新的技术和方法,以适应不断变化的市场环境。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态